    They just need a 10 signup minimum for the track to open for the day during the winter. Car guys get the minimum all the time. Bikes don't. They really don't staff any different for 10 than they would for 50. The problem is getting the minimum. If you pay as a walkup it is $10 more, so early online signup is the financially prudent thing to do.
